TCF Canada Exam Fees in India: 2026 Cost Breakdown

TCF Canada is offered in India through approved test centers — primarily Alliance Française branches in cities like Delhi, Mumbai, Bengaluru, Chennai, Pune, Kolkata, Hyderabad, and Chandigarh. Each center sets and collects its own fee, so the exact amount varies by city and can change without much notice. Treat the figures below as a planning estimate, and confirm the current price directly with your nearest center before you register.

Approximate fee

Candidates commonly report paying somewhere in the range of ₹25,000–28,000 (including GST) for the full four-skill TCF Canada test — roughly USD $300–340 depending on the exchange rate and center. Some centers price slightly higher or lower, and promotional periods or early-registration discounts can shift the number too.

What's included

The standard fee covers all four skills used for Express Entry and most Canadian economic immigration programs: compréhension orale (listening), compréhension écrite (reading), expression orale (speaking), and expression écrite (writing). A few centers allow listening-and-reading-only registration at a lower price if that's all a specific program requires — check what your target program needs before you register for a partial test, since most immigration pathways require all four.

Payment and GST

Fees quoted by Indian centers are typically inclusive of GST, but confirm this when you register — some centers list the base fee and add tax separately. Payment is usually made directly to the test center (bank transfer, card, or an online payment link), not to France Éducation International directly. Keep your payment receipt; you'll generally need it to confirm your booking and may need it again if you request a transfer or refund.

Extra costs to budget for

  • Retake fees.If your score doesn't hit the CLB band you need, a retake means paying the full fee again — there's no discounted repeat rate.
  • Cancellation or rescheduling fees.Many centers charge a non-refundable fee if you cancel or change your date after registering — check the specific center's policy before you book.
  • Travel.If there's no center in your city, factor in travel and possibly an overnight stay for exam day.
  • Prep courses or tutoring. Optional, but common if you go beyond self-study.
